Debate: The Netherlands in shock after attack on reporter

Thu, 08/07/2021 - 12:47
In Amsterdam, the award-winning investigative journalist Peter R. de Vries was shot and critically injured on Tuesday. De Vries has uncovered numerous crimes and police corruption and had a popular TV show covering high-profile criminal cases. Most recently, he acted as an adviser to the chief witness in a major trial against members of a criminal gang. For commentators, the attempted assassination was not only directed against de Vries personally.

Debate: Migration: London wants "most radical changes"

Thu, 08/07/2021 - 12:47
The UK plans to drastically tighten its asylum law. British Home Secretary Priti Patel spoke of the "most radical changes in decades". The plans include life imprisonment for smugglers, the interception of boats on the open sea and reception centres in third countries. Anyone entering the country illegally will have fewer rights from the outset. Not only aid organisations are appalled.

Debate: Löfven re-elected: Swedish politics back on track?

Thu, 08/07/2021 - 12:47
Two weeks after losing a vote of no confidence and one week after resigning, Sweden's Social Democratic Prime Minister Stefan Löfven has been re-elected by a narrow majority. The vote of no confidence was initiated by the right-wing populist Sweden Democrats after the Social Democrats and the Left Party had a falling-out. Observers point to numerous flaws in Sweden's political landscape.

Debate: Afghanistan: what comes after the troops leave?

Thu, 08/07/2021 - 12:47
As the US and Nato troops withdraw from Afghanistan, the Taliban are expanding their influence in the country. They recently seized ten districts in the south and have surrounded almost all the major cities in the country. On Sunday night 1,037 Afghan soldiers crossed into Tajikistan after fighting on the border. A somber mood prevails in Europe's press.

Debate: What are the chances for Israel's new government?

Fri, 04/06/2021 - 12:07
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u has called on MPs on Twitter to oppose the new government coalition announced by opposition leader Yair Lapid on Wednesday. With 61 of the 120 seats in the Knesset, the coalition has a razor thin majority. Europe's media doubt whether the new government can really bring about change - and whether Netanyahu will really have to step down after 12 years.
